Transaction 7594fc99fcbef0304371837d116eb546bd0be596f078009c8b149aeef6f4451c

1 Input
2 Outputs
  • 7594fc99fcbef0304371837d116eb546bd0be596f078009c8b149aeef6f4451c:0
  • value  322535584
    address  bc1qe2vd57h39ar9qwweft6lc3sxn26jd5f46h98qk
  • 7594fc99fcbef0304371837d116eb546bd0be596f078009c8b149aeef6f4451c:1
  • value  683409
    address  322jsWvm5WdPyN5W8pJdPkKWoxkUr42JLZ